Why You Should Include More Dates in Your Diet: 9 Key Reasons

Dates, frequently referred to as “nature’s sweets,” offer more than just a scrumptious, sugary taste—they’re also loaded with crucial nutrients and antioxidants that deliver numerous health advantages. Dates have been cherished for generations for both their taste and healing properties, making them a fantastic inclusion to a well-rounded diet. From enhancing digestion to potentially decreasing the risk of chronic illnesses, here are nine significant rationales to integrate more dates into your day-to-day dishes:

1. Eases Constipation

If you’re experiencing constipation, dates can serve as a natural solution. Their considerable fiber content supports regular bowel movements, aiding in alleviating distress and enhancing digestive well-being.

2. Abundant in Antioxidants

Dates are abundant in potent antioxidants, which combat detrimental free radicals and diminish oxidative tension. With the most significant concentration of polyphenols among dried fruits, they might offer protection against chronic ailments and premature aging.

3. Brimming with Vitamins and Minerals

An exceptional source of essential vitamins and minerals, dates supply vitamin B6, iron, potassium, and magnesium. These nutrients are vital for energy generation, nerve function, and sustaining robust bones and muscles.

4. Supports Skeletal Health

Dates encompass bone-fortifying minerals such as calcium, magnesium, phosphorus, and potassium, all indispensable for preserving bone density. They also contain vitamin K, which aids in calcium assimilation, fostering sturdier bones and teeth.

5. Enhances Cognitive Function

Studies indicate that dates could bolster brain health by lessening inflammation and aiding in averting the formation of plaques linked to neurodegenerative ailments like Alzheimer’s. Their antioxidants also contribute to conserving cognitive performance.

6. Enhances Hair Well-being

The elevated iron content in dates boosts heightened blood circulation to the scalp, which may stimulate accelerated hair growth and fortify hair follicles. This enhanced circulation might also diminish hair loss and result in healthier, glossier hair.

7. Could Lower Cancer Hazard

The fiber and polyphenols in dates are associated with a diminished risk of colorectal cancer. Consistent consumption of dates could enhance gut health, which has a role in reducing cancer susceptibility.

8. Aids in Regulating Blood Sugar

Despite their innate sweetness, dates possess a low glycemic index, signifying they won’t trigger swift spikes in blood sugar levels. Their fiber content additionally assists in slowing down sugar absorption, rendering dates a suitable snack for individuals with diabetes.

9. Fosters Cardiovascular Health

Dates can contribute to improved heart health by aiding in managing cholesterol levels and reducing oxidative tension. The fiber and antioxidants present in dates bolster cardiovascular well-being, making them a heart-friendly addition to your regimen.

Incorporating dates into your everyday regimen is a straightforward means to relish their inherent sweetness while enjoying a variety of health perks. Whether you consume them solo or include them in your preferred dishes, dates offer an array of vitamins, minerals, and fiber that can amplify your comprehensive well-being, particularly concerning digestion, cardiovascular health, and brain functionality.
